Osaka falls at US Open as forehand goes awry
Briefly

Osaka’s struggles were evident as she dropped five consecutive games and faced an uphill battle, eventually succumbing to Muchova despite showing signs of improvement in the second set.
With a chance to win, Osaka served for the second set at 5-4 but faltered, making five unforced errors, including a double-fault that led to her elimination.
